Nine Earn All-Region Honors As Wrestling Sits In Second Place Through Day One Of Region II Championships

Five Ducks To Compete In Semifinals on Saturday

Ithaca, N.Y. – The Stevens Institute of Technology wrestling team collected 86.5 points on the first day of the Region II Championships, with nine competitors earning All-Region honors and five still alive in their quest to earn an automatic berth into the NCAA Championships.

The Ducks are just 7.5 points back of the host Bombers, and sit 19 points clear of any other team, with more wrestlers (nine) still alive than any of the other 19 competing schools.

THE RUNDOWN
Nico Diaz (141), Cole Handlovic (149), and Ryan Smith (157) all lived up to their No. 1 seeds in their respective classes. Diaz posted wins by major decision and technical fall; Handlovic posted two wins by major decision (conceding three total points); Smith earned a first-period fall and a major decision win.

Tyler Roe was the only Duck to collect three victories on Friday, as the No. 6 seed at 165 picked up two technical falls and a major decision.

Ian Flanagan clocked the final 2-0 day for the Ducks, earning a major decision win and a decision win as the No. 4 seed at 174.
The 125-lb. No. 5 seed, Charles Piccione wrestled three decisions, picking up two wins, including his final match of the day in the consolation bracket.

Noah MacIlroy, the 184-lb. No. 4 seed, opened his day with a decision win and ended it with a major decision in the consolation draw.

Terrence Thomas was knocked to the consolation bracket after his first match of the day, but the No. 11 seed at 197 earned All-Region status with wins by major decision and decision.

After opening his day with a decision win, Noah Berlin-Langston, the No. 8 seed at heavyweight suffered a loss via pin to the draw's No. 1 seed, but rebounded with a technical fall in his first match in the consolation draw.

At 133 lbs., No. 21 Vincent Principe faced three Top-7 opponents, picking up a technical fall win before being eliminated from the competition.

UP NEXT
The Ducks will seek a sixth straight regional championship tomorrow, as competition resumes at 10:00 AM.
